Runbook: Searchgrove relevance tuning. Boost changes go through the weights table, not code. Reviewers: reject any PR that hardcodes boosts. Rebuild the index after each weights change and diff the top-20 results for the golden queries. To inspect current weights, connect to the tuning database using the string below.

warehouse DSN: clickhouse://druys_svc:Pl@db-47e1.orvexstack.corp:5432/beldor

Welcome to the Tidemark autoscaler team. If the autoscaler's service account is locked out — usually after a credential rotation that the queue-depth poller missed — scaling decisions freeze at the last known depth, which can silently starve the worker pool. First confirm the lockout in the control plane audit log, then notify the on-call before recovering, since recovery restarts the poller and briefly doubles queue reads. Recovery is performed from the bastion console, where you will be prompted for the passphrase below.

vault phrase of taweg-kafof = oliax-zorael

Ticket: Stale prices in the Marrowfield product catalog after bulk updates. Cause appears to be the edge cache keeping category pages past their TTL because the invalidation fanout skips nested collections. New folks: reproduce by bulk-editing any category with children, then fetching the child page. Fix likely belongs in the purge worker. The affected deployment is identified by the token below.

session token of bawep-yadup = htk21_528abd376e3c5a4ec24a1

**CI note: timezone weirdness in report exports**

Heads up, support folks — if a customer says their Ledgerpine export shows times shifted by a few hours, it's probably the CI image. The export workers got rebuilt last week and the base image defaults to UTC, while older workers used the account's locale. Fix is rolling out; meanwhile tell customers the data itself is fine, just the display offset. Affected exports carry the build token shown below.

build token for bajof-tahop: htk4_a981